Now to the meat of the review. 2K is a good basketball simulation when played correctly. I happen to think that the correct way to play the game is on Hall of Fame difficulty. I have played maybe 15 games on Hall of Fame so far and only won maybe 5. The game get's really addictive when you give yourself a challenge. You must consider that I had not played a basketball video game consistently since 2K8. As for game-play,this game feels totally different than 2K8. The pace is slower and the defense is difficult to get down on Hall of Fame. It is frustrating to see that your teammates allow too many easy cuts and leads to the basket. They also allow for guys that are known shooters to pop out for uncontested 3 pointers. It is difficult to play on ball defense also. Offensively, the shot stick or even the face button used to shoot with fails way to often, making it difficult to make even wide open jump shots. As for graphics, this game looks really good even without a HDTV. The presentation is good but could be better, especially if you consider how great NFL 2K5's presentation was at that time. Finally, graphically, presentation wise, and game-play wise this is a good and addictive game to play. My suggestion, ramp it up to Hall of Fame and get the true feel of competition.
